Re: Reboot issue volume of EDA500
RAID-0 in the EDA500 wouldn't help with performance and performance is the key reason to use RAID-0. Not caring about data loss where the performance isn't going to be helped by using RAID-0, using a separate volume for each disk would be better than one big RAID-0 volume.

Re: Reboot issue volume of EDA500
RAID-0 on an EDA wouldn't lead to a performance gain. In the main chassis it would if you are using teaming and are able to take advantage of that, but in the EDA there isn't a performance reason to use RAID-0.
